Shah Shaival currently serves as an Applied Mechanics Engineer - Group Leader at Cummins Inc., where he leverages his expertise in multibody dynamic analysis to drive innovation in powertrain systems. With a solid foundation in automobile engineering, Shah is adept at analyzing complex mechanisms, particularly focusing on crank train and valve train dynamics. His role involves leading a team of engineers in the development and optimization of advanced automotive components, ensuring that they meet stringent performance and reliability standards.
One of Shah's key projects involves utilizing AVL Excite Power Unit and ABAQUS for comprehensive simulations that enhance the understanding of multibody dynamics in powertrain applications. His expert-level skills in these software tools enable him to conduct detailed analyses that inform design decisions and improve overall system efficiency.
